Understanding Master Data Management

Master Data Management (MDM) is about managing essential data in an organized way to ensure accuracy, consistency, and reliability. It involves creating and maintaining a single, reliable version of essential business data, which is commonly referred to as master data. Master data includes information like customers, products, suppliers, and employees shared across different systems and business processes. 

 

What is Master Data

Master data refers to the essential and core data entities shared across different systems and business processes within an organization. It represents the fundamental information about customers, products, suppliers, employees, and other critical entities vital to the organization’s operations and decision-making. Master data provides a consistent and reliable foundation for various applications and systems to work cohesively and generate accurate insights. It serves as a single source of truth for these entities, ensuring uniformity, accuracy, and integrity across the organization. By managing master data effectively, organizations can achieve data harmonization, streamline processes, and make informed decisions based on a unified and reliable data foundation. 

 

Key Components of Master Data Management: 

  1. Data Governance: Data governance is a crucial component of MDM. It involves managing data consistently according to set rules, policies, and standards. Data governance ensures data is structured, with clear roles and responsibilities assigned to individuals or teams. It helps establish data stewardship roles, define data quality rules, and enforce data management best practices. By implementing data governance, organizations can ensure the integrity, reliability, and compliance of their master data. 
  2. Data Integration: Data integration plays a significant role in MDM by bringing together data from disparate sources and systems. It eliminates data silos, where data is isolated and stored in separate databases or applications and creates a unified view of the master data. Data integration techniques may include data consolidation, cleansing, and synchronization. Through data integration, technical staff can ensure that all systems and applications across the organization can access accurate and up-to-date master data, enabling a holistic understanding of the business. 
  3. Data Quality Management: Data quality management is another critical component of MDM. It focuses on maintaining high-quality, accurate, consistent data throughout its lifecycle. Data quality management involves various activities, including data profiling, cleansing, validation, and monitoring. Data profiling helps organizations understand the quality and consistency of their existing data by analyzing its completeness, accuracy, and consistency. Data cleansing involves identifying and resolving data errors, redundancies, and inconsistencies to improve data accuracy. Data validation ensures that the master data meets predefined quality standards and is fit for its intended purpose. Data monitoring involves ongoing checks and audits to maintain data quality over time. 

 

Implementation Strategies for Master Data Management 

Successful implementation of MDM requires a well-defined strategy and careful planning. The following techniques can guide technical staff in implementing MDM effectively: 

  1. Assessing Data Needs: Before embarking with a MDM implementation, organizations must evaluate their data needs. This involves identifying the critical master data entities essential for business operations and decision-making. By understanding the data requirements, including data elements, structures, and relationships, technical staff can ensure that the MDM solution aligns with the organization’s specific needs. 
  2. Data Profiling and Cleansing: Data profiling and cleansing are essential with a MDM implementation. Data profiling helps organizations understand the quality and consistency of their existing data. Technical staff can identify data errors, redundancies, and inconsistencies by analyzing the data’s completeness, accuracy, and consistency. Data cleansing involves resolving these issues to improve data accuracy and reliability. Technical staff can leverage various tools and techniques to perform data profiling and cleansing effectively. 
  3. Data Integration: Data integration is a fundamental aspect of MDM. It involves bringing together data from disparate sources and systems to create a unified view of the master data. Technical staff can ensure data integration by mapping data fields, establishing data transformation rules, and ensuring data consistency across systems. Organizations can eliminate data silos and achieve a holistic view of their data assets through effective data integration strategies. 
  4. Data Governance Framework: Establishing a data governance framework is crucial for successful MDM implementation. It ensures data is managed consistently and according to defined policies and standards. Technical staff can contribute to the development of a data governance framework by defining roles and responsibilities, establishing data quality rules, and enforcing data management best practices. By implementing a robust data governance framework, organizations can ensure the integrity, reliability, and compliance of their master data. 
  5. Technology Selection: Choosing the right MDM technology solution is essential for successful implementation. Technical staff should evaluate various MDM tools and platforms based on factors such as scalability, integration capabilities, data security, and user-friendliness. By selecting the appropriate technology, organizations can ensure that their MDM solution aligns with their specific requirements and can effectively support their data management needs. 

 

Benefits of Master Data Management:

  1. Improved Data Quality and Consistency: MDM ensures that master data is accurate, consistent, and reliable. Organizations can make more informed decisions, improve operational efficiency, and enhance customer satisfaction by maintaining high-quality data
  2. Efficient Data Governance: MDM establishes a robust data governance framework, ensuring that data is managed consistently and according to defined policies and standards. Technical staff can contribute to efficient data governance by adhering to data quality rules, enforcing data management best practices, and participating in data stewardship roles. 
  3. Enhanced Decision-Making: With MDM, organizations gain a holistic and accurate view of their data assets. Technical staff can leverage this unified view to make informed decisions based on reliable up-to-date data. By having access to high-quality master data, organizations can drive business growth and competitive advantage. 
  4. Streamlined Operations: MDM streamlines business processes by providing consistent, up-to-date data across systems. Technical staff can ensure data integrity and eliminate redundancies, reducing errors and inefficiencies. Streamlined operations lead to improved productivity and cost savings. 
  5. Regulatory Compliance: MDM assists organizations in meeting regulatory requirements by ensuring data accuracy, traceability, and privacy. Technical staff can play a crucial role in implementing data governance policies and procedures to ensure compliance with relevant regulations and standards.
